数据分析需要哪些软件

发表时间:2025-07-01 22:23:42文章来源:数据分析招聘网

在当今数字化时代,数据分析变得越来越重要。无论是企业制定战略决策,还是科研人员进行学术研究,都离不开对大量数据的分析和解读。而要进行有效的数据分析,选择合适的软件至关重要。不同的软件有着不同的功能和适用场景,接下来我们就来详细了解一下数据分析中常用的软件。

Excel:基础且实用的数据分析工具

Excel是一款广为人知且被广泛使用的办公软件,它在数据分析领域也有着重要的地位。其操作相对简单,容易上手,即使是没有专业数据分析背景的人员也能快速掌握。

1. 数据整理与清洗:Excel可以对数据进行排序、筛选、删除重复值等操作,让数据变得更加规范和有条理。例如,在处理销售数据时,我们可以通过筛选功能快速找出某个时间段内的高销售额产品。

2. 数据可视化:Excel提供了多种图表类型,如柱状图、折线图、饼图等。通过将数据转化为直观的图表,我们可以更清晰地看出数据的趋势和关系。比如,用折线图展示公司历年的销售额变化情况。

3. 函数计算:Excel内置了丰富的函数,如求和、平均值、计数等。利用这些函数可以快速进行数据计算和分析。例如,计算员工的平均工资、销售总额等。

Python:强大的数据分析编程语言

Python是一种高级编程语言,在数据分析领域得到了广泛应用。它具有丰富的库和工具,能够处理复杂的数据分析任务。

Python中有很多用于数据分析的库,如NumPy、Pandas和Matplotlib。NumPy提供了高效的多维数组对象和计算工具;Pandas可以方便地进行数据处理和分析;Matplotlib则用于数据可视化。例如,在进行股票数据分析时,我们可以使用Pandas读取和处理股票数据,用Matplotlib绘制股票价格走势图。

Python的代码可以自动化执行数据分析任务,提高工作效率。比如,编写一个脚本定时从数据库中提取数据并进行分析,生成报表。同时,Python拥有庞大的开源社区,遇到问题可以很容易地找到解决方案和相关资源。

SPSS:专业的统计分析软件

SPSS是一款专业的统计分析软件,它提供了丰富的统计分析方法,适用于社会科学、医学、市场研究等多个领域。

SPSS具有直观的界面和操作方式,即使是没有深厚统计学知识的用户也能进行基本的统计分析。它可以进行描述性统计分析,如计算均值、标准差等;还能进行相关性分析、回归分析等高级统计分析。例如,在市场调研中,通过相关性分析找出影响产品销量的因素。

在进行复杂的统计分析时,SPSS提供了详细的结果输出和解释,帮助用户理解分析结果。同时,它还支持数据导入和导出功能,可以与其他软件进行数据交互。

Tableau:优秀的数据可视化软件

Tableau是一款专注于数据可视化的软件,它可以将复杂的数据转化为直观、美观的可视化图表和报表。

Tableau具有强大的可视化功能,能够创建各种类型的图表和可视化界面。它可以连接多种数据源,如数据库、电子表格等,方便用户快速获取和分析数据。例如,企业可以用Tableau将销售数据、市场数据等进行整合,生成全面的可视化报表。

Tableau的操作相对简单,用户可以通过拖放的方式快速创建可视化图表。同时,它还支持实时数据更新,让用户随时了解数据的最新情况。

综上所述,数据分析需要根据不同的需求和场景选择合适的软件。Excel适合基础的数据处理和简单分析;Python功能强大,可用于复杂的数据分析和自动化任务;SPSS是专业统计分析的首选;Tableau则在数据可视化方面表现出色。希望通过本文的介绍,能帮助你更好地选择适合自己的数据分析软件,提高数据分析的效率和质量。